跳转到内容

安装

安装 CLI

公共 npm 包

Terminal window
npm install -g @imbrace/cli

从源码安装

克隆仓库并运行安装脚本:

Terminal window
git clone https://github.com/imbraceltd/imbrace-cli.git
cd imbrace-cli
./install.sh

install.sh 依次运行 npm installnpm run buildnpm link,然后将 imbrace 符号链接到 /opt/homebrew/bin(Apple Silicon)或 /usr/local/bin(Intel)。

手动构建

Terminal window
cd cli
npm install
npm run build
npm link

认证

所有命令(login 除外)在未认证时会自动提示登录。

使用 API Key 登录

推荐用于 CI/CD 和编码代理:

Terminal window
imbrace login --api-key api_xxx...

使用邮箱 + 密码登录

Terminal window
imbrace login --email user@example.com --password mypass

查看当前登录状态

Terminal window
imbrace whoami [--json]

退出登录

Terminal window
imbrace logout

凭证存储

操作系统路径
macOS~/Library/Preferences/imbrace-nodejs/config.json
Linux~/.config/imbrace-nodejs/config.json
Windows%APPDATA%\imbrace-nodejs\Config\config.json